I was contacted by Denise Rich and the G&P Foundation for Cancer Research, an organization that was created in 1996 by Denise Rich in memory of her daughter Gabrielle Rich Aouad, who passed away at the age of 27 after a long and valiant struggle with Acute Myelogenous Leukemia (AML). The foundation is the product of Gabrielle's wish; that a foundation be created to help spare others the suffering that she endured.
